Word of caution: the NA TF10 pin fit will be hit & miss due to tolerances. My first set (Arete) were extremely tight to get onto the FLC8s and I'm wary to remove them now. My second cable (Lune) were a better fit, tight but not as tight, to get on a second set of FLC8s. Other connector types I've ordered through NA also have been hit & miss.Try NullAudio Arete MkIII. Much better than original cable. No microphonics, sleeved, copper bodied IEM connector. Also cheaper than LMUE cable replacements - just 99 SGD. Use UE TF10 connector by customisation.
